Out-of-Push Authentication, aka. Out Of Band Authentication (OOBA), aka, Push Authentication, is one of the most secure forms of two-factor authentication. In an OOBA system, the network or channel used for user authentication is out of band - it is completely separated from the network or channel used for user login. Therefore, the possibility that both networks or channels are compromised by an intruder at the same time in a short period of time while a user is attempting to login is far less than that in a single band system.

DualShield can support supports 3 channels of Out-of-Band authentication, mobile data network, SMS message and voice over telephone.
